About the Club

Flow Shala is a global fitness education brand and offers Online Courses, 1:1 Private Coaching and the world's only 100 Hour Steel Mace Vinyasa Teacher Training.
Owner and Head Coach Summer Huntington, specializes in Holistic Movement Coaching & program design for clients with health concerns like:

Mental Health - ADHD, Stress, Anxiety & Depression
Personal Development Goals
Women's Hormone Shifts
Thyroid Disorder
Fertility
Chronic Pain
Aging Adults & Posture

We offer programs for all levels, just reach out!
